Serves Chinese and Singaporean vegetarian zi char dishes, fried 'oyster,' fried rice, fried noodle, yong tau foo, and laksa. Accepts GrabPay. Open Mon-Sun 11:00am-11:00pm.

Very addictive

Heard some really good reviews from close friends in the vegan community so I decided to give this stall a go.

As we had other foods waiting at our table, we decided to just order one small dish so we won’t waste food at all.
We tried the Gong Bao Monkey Head mushroom as recommended by the young lady working here, and boy was the dish so good! It’s stir fried with the usual dark sauce used for Gong Bao dishes, along with strips of ginger, capsicum, tomato and dried chilli, and it’s got that lil hint of wokhei flavour to it.

Definitely trying their food the next time I visit this hawker centre
